I've been looking for a used assembly the past 5 months and finally bit the bullet and got a new one from Quirkparts off of ebay. A lot of old ones are pitted and since they are glass can't be polished like plastic. One thing to note, the one I got must have been of a newer design then the 2005 since it didn't have a metal bulb (domed) cover. I had to take apart the old foglight and use the back of the housing. Hopefully the design change was already in place for 2008 models. Get yourself a new one.

No replacements are available except the OEM ones and as you see these get pricey. See if you can get a used one, but even those reach $100+ if in good shape. Look at the glass before buying some look very pitted so try and match what you have now.
